ONCHAN, Isle of Man, June 28, 2023 /PRNewswire/ -- After a successful inaugural year, and as part of their ongoing commitment to grow the game and ensure poker remains as open and accessible to all, PokerStars has announced the return of the 2023 PokerStars x Poker Power Women's Bootcamp. 

Taking place from July 31-September 28, 2023, the Bootcamp is aimed at those who are looking to take their first steps into the world of poker and learn strategies and skills to develop resilience, determination, and patience. Made up of eight modules, each one will focus on a different area of poker, while also demonstrating how core gameplay skills can translate to real world success: from negotiation and strategic decision-making to capital allocation.

As well as the Bootcamp being open to women around the world, those who take part will also be able to put their learning into practice as they play PokerStars Home Games. The Bootcamp will lead to a crescendo tournament whereby a final table of recruits will win an all-expenses paid trip to EPT Cyprus this October to take part in the PokerStars x Poker Power Women's Bootcamp Showdown to compete further for a special package to EPT Prague this December.

The announcement follows new research carried out in the UK by PokerStars citing over half of women (55 per cent) do not feel poker is inclusive to them, despite 42 per cent of women who play, believe it brings improved focus and concentration and 38 per cent believing it could improve decision making ability.

Applications to the Bootcamp are now open with the recruitment window closing on July 22. Those who take part will be able to learn from expert Poker Power instructors using the Poker Power Play app, and PokerStars Ambassadors such as Lali Tournier, Georgina James and Jennifer Shahade who will be on hand to provide their support and top tips.

Further tools such as PokerStars Learn will be available 24/7 for participants to advance their skills in their own time, enabling them to learn hand rankings and familiarise themselves with the format of online poker, for those who haven't played before or for those in need of a refresher session.

About Poker Power

Poker Power is a company led by women for women with the goal of teaching one million women how to play the game —the game of poker and the game of life. Through a global network of clubs, tournaments, and corporate events, Poker Power utilizes a proprietary curriculum and gameplay (not gambling) to help women build confidence, challenge the status quo, learn strategy, and assess risk in a fun, supportive, safe-to-fail environment.
